A flexible hybrid capacitor based an NiCo<sub>2</sub>S<sub>4</sub> nanowire electrode with an ultrahigh capacitance
Tong Xia, Ying Liu, Meizhen Dai, Qing Xia, Xiang Wu
Abstract
In this study, we synthesized NiCo<sub>2</sub>S<sub>4</sub> nanowire bundles on a nickel foam <italic>via</italic> facile hydrothermal routes. The assembled asymmetric supercapacitor exhibits excellent mechanical stability even at different bending angles.
